At Upper Holloway, simplicity is key. There is no ticket office, but ticket machines are readily available to purchase and collect tickets for your travel. These machines are accessible, making it easy for everyone to buy their tickets without hassle. The station is equipped with induction loops to aid those with hearing impairments, and ramps are available for train access, though it's worth noting the station has partial step-free accessibility.
While there are no waiting rooms or rest facilities, the station maintains a certain straightforward charm. Security is a priority, with CCTV cameras ensuring a safe environment for all travelers. Although there are no shopping or dining facilities on-site, the surrounding areas offer enticing options to satisfy your needs before or after your journey.
Upper Holloway is a gateway to the city, with links to various transport modes. The London Overground services tread through this station, and for those looking to explore further afield, the Archway Underground Station is just a five-minute walk away. This access to the Northern Line opens up connections to vast parts of London, enhancing your travel experience. For bus travelers, nearby stops offer East and Westbound services ensuring seamless travel across London. Unfortunately, there isn't a dedicated parking area, but bike stands accommodate cyclists who wish to pedal their way through the city.

At Pentre-Bach, purchasing and collecting tickets is straightforward. While there isn't a sta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available for customers to coll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ines support major debit and credit card transactions but do not accept cash. Smartcard validators are installed, offering modern convenience for travelers familiar with digital ticketing systems.
Accessibility is a priority at Pentre-Bach. The station is categorized as Accessible (Category A), with step-free access from the main road to the platform,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. However,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or designated waiting rooms, though seating areas are provided. Cyclists are welcomed with four sheltered bike spaces monitored by CCTV, ensuring that bicycle storage is secure.
Pentre-Bach facilitates easy onward travel for passengers. For those reliant on buses, the nearest stops are conveniently located on Merthyr Road, offering significant connectivity with local routes. Additionally, the rail replacement bus service also stops nearby the station entrance, ensuring continued mobility in case of any disruptions. Although direct taxi services and car hire options may not be available at the station itself, the location’s connectivity supports alternative travel arrangements.
